he went into the Guinness Book of World Records as the youngest female artist to write, perform, and produce a Number One hit, with her 1988 ballad “Foolish Beat.”
Who is the youngest male artist to write, perform, and produce a Number One hit?
― like a d4mn sociopath! (morrisp), Friday, 4 June 2021 16:58 (four years ago)
looks like whoever it is, he came after her:
With the coronation, Gibson became the youngest artist to write, produce and perform a Hot 100 No. 1; she remains the youngest female artist to do so.
